This 1877 map is a color illustration of a bird's eye view of the Village of Farmington, Stafford County, New Hampshire. Not drawn to scale. Includes labeled roads, homes, buildings, waterways and the railroad route. Also has a featured drawing inset of the High School at the time.
Notable places found include:
High School.
Public School.
Reservoir.
B. & M. R. R. Depot.
Post Office.
Mechanics Hotel. S. Varney, Proprietor.
Congregational Church.
Baptist Church.
Advent Church.
Cemetery.
A. Nute & Sons, Shoe Factory.
J. F. Cloutman’s Shoe Factory.
J. M. Berry’s Shoe Factory.
M. L. Hayes’ Shoe Factory.
Geo. A. Jones, Shoe Factory.
E. O. Curtis’ Shoe Factory.
J. Hayes & Sons, Shoe Factory.
D. W. Kimball’s Shoe Factory.
H. B. & J. B. Edgerly’s Shoe Factory.
W. W. Hayes, Saw & Planing Mills.
L. S. Flanders, Last Factory.
J. P. Tibbetts Carriage Factory.
Excelsior Mills.
Saw Mills.
